Serves meat, vegan options available. Coffee shop & restaurant in a renovated 17th century townhouse. Vegan items include grilled tofu on toast, beetroot burger, cauliflower steak, avocado on toast and vegan pancakes. Open Mon-Sat 09:00-16:00, Sun 10:00-16:00.

Exciting Vegan Options and Nice Vibe

Flat White Kitchen is a really good option for brunch in Durham, with a few vegan options including seasonal vegan pancakes, vegan breakfast bowl, and avocado on toast. The vegan breakfast bowl offers scrambled tofu, hummus, tomatoes, sourdough, beans, and sautéed kale (showing a little more effort than a cooked tomato, some mushrooms, and a vegan sausage, which is nice). But, with my sweet tooth I'm more drawn to the vegan pancakes they offer. I have tried the vegan rhubarb crumble pancakes which were yummy, with thick pancakes and a sweet and almost tangy taste from the rhubarb compote.
During my most recent visit I tried the vegan poached pear, walnut crumble, and custard pancakes which were really nice, with a sharp, unique flavour from the poached pear, and a good amount of custard.
I believe they have also done vegan matcha pancakes before, I didn't try them but I'm sure they were great.
They also do good drinks, I usually go for the vegan chai latte with soya milk which is really nice (good balance between floral-ness and sweetness). My dad got raspberry and rhubarb matcha with oat milk (I'm not sure I like matcha so it wasn't my cup of tea personally, but my dad liked it).
The vibes are also really nice, with lots of plants dotted around and cool fish-shaped bottles of water on each table, and the staff are always friendly. Definitely worth a visit for filling portions and exciting flavours.

Tasty coffee

This beautiful cafe is in the heart of Durham. The coffee was delicious, one of the best in Durham. They also have some vegan options which are nice. Discretionary Service Charge is included in the bill, you must ask to remove it if you don't want to pay for it.
